Output 6a30742d04109e70bacbb4e4d926b5b01a1546e821aafd78d86c371430721e3b:0

value
6978774000361
script pubkey
OP_0 OP_PUSHBYTES_20 8e37a3e838ea44d91eabdf75361549f263f462dc
address
tb1q3cm686pcafzdj84tma6nv92f7f3lgckunpjpes
transaction
6a30742d04109e70bacbb4e4d926b5b01a1546e821aafd78d86c371430721e3b
confirmations
190450
spent
true